http://www.alien-news.org/ Sean McCormack, US State Department Spokesman has released a special statement with respect to Russia's latest intention of increasing additional military contingent in Abkhazia (Georgia's one of two breakaway regions and "frozen conflict zones").
Washington expresses its grave concern over the May 31 statement that of Internal Affairs Ministry of the Russian Federation with concern to deploying railway military units in Abkhazia without prior consent of the Georgian side.
According to Mr. McCormack's assessment, the latest Russia's decision is even more incomprehensible now that Georgia announced at the UN Security Session, held on May 30, over its intention to cease flying of Georgian spy jets over the Abkhazian territory. As Mr. McCormack stressed, US had already informed Russia of its standpoint regarding the increase of military units in Georgia's breakaway Abkhazia on the part of big stick Russia.
Russia began deploying railway military units in Abkhazia upon the instruction of Dmitry Medvedev, Russia's new president as of yesterday, May 31.
"Special heavy vehicles of the Russian railway military units are working on the Abkhazian territory to improve the current infrastructure," reads the May 31 Russian Defense Ministry's statement. The Russian side presumes completion of rehabilitation works on Ochamchire-Sokhumi section of the railway line in 2-3 months.
Grigol Vashadze, Deputy Georgian Foreign Minister said Russia once again violated the Georgian state sovereignty with this latest move.
